摘要
将自然同步化的多头绒泡菌原生质团中的S期、G2早期、G2中期和G2晚期细胞核提取出来 ,经SDS PAGE发现一条分子量为 43kD的多肽 ,经Westenblot证明为肌动蛋白 ,凝胶染色后 ,发现细胞周期不同期相的肌动蛋白带着色深浅不同 :G2早期染色最深 ,G2晚期染色最浅 .电泳凝胶扫描表明肌动蛋白相对含量依细胞周期期相不同而具有动态变化 :G2早期相对含量最高 ,达 6 9% ;G2晚期相对含量最低 ,为 2 3% .
Nuclei at S, early G2, middle G2, late G2 and M phases of the cell cycle were isolated from the naturally synchronized plasmodia of Physarum polycephalum. A 43kD polypeptide was revealed in the nuclear proteins of all the phases by SDS PAGE and was then proved to be actin by Western blot analysis. The actin bands in different phases showed a difference in their darkness after staining: the darkest was found in early G2 phase while the lightest turned to be in the late G2 phase. Gelscan of the SDS PAGE gels indicated a phase dependent dynamic change in the relative content of actin: it reached the maximum 6 9% of the whole nuclear proteins in the early G2 phase and then dropped to the minimum 2 3% in the late G2 phase.
